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
515084 5605707 4770 40623
48 641063
48 641063
57497846 8766 322 7249 76828
All about undefined
Interested in learning more?
48 641063
57497846 8766 322 7249 76828
See more
36368460257 8371504992
90575 32 976
See more
8539166801 720
1661275366 34 89232357950 736572228 8772
See more